> The review in the April CQ magazine addresses the key input and paddle
input
> connections.   You can turn off the internal keyer in the menu, and plug
an
> external keyer into the radio a number of ways.   The ptt connector on the
> front, the key jack in the back (which can be used for paddles or straight
> key), and there is also a PTT terminal on the accessory connector which is
> normally used for things like a foot switch, but could be used to key the
> radio.
>
> The radio has the ability to download software updates via a computer; but
I
> am not sure if the frequency selection can be accessed for direct
frequency
> entry.  It seems likely you have to go thru the control program.  Since it
> is capable of the several digital modes, there is a lot of ability built
> into the radio.
